1.使用merge()方法合并数据集 Pandas提供了一个函数merge,作为DataFrame对象之间所有标准数据库连接操作的入口点。merge()是Python最常用的函数之一,类似于Excel中的vlookup函数,它的作用是可以根据一个或多个键将不同的数据集链接起来。我们来看一下函数的语法:merge的参数如下:pd.merge( left, right, how=‘inner...
🔄 在Python的数据分析中,merge函数是一个强大的工具,它可以根据一个或多个键将数据行进行连接。这个函数主要用于将各种join操作算法应用到数据上,并且会自动将重叠的列名作为连接的键。🔑 当连接的键在两个对象中的列名不同时,你可以使用left_on和right_on参数来指定这些键。默认情况下,merge函数执行的是内连接...
dataframe_1, dataframe_2,how="inner") 参数how有四个选项,分别是:inner、outer、left、right。 inner是merge函数的默认参数,意思是将dataframe_1和dataframe_2两表中主键一致的行保留下来,然后合并列。 outer是相对于inner来说的,outer不会仅仅保留主键一致的行,还会将不一致的部分填充Nan然后保留下来。 然后是le...
当连接键位于索引中时,成为索引上的合并,可以通过merge函数,传入left_index、right_index来说明应该被索引的情况。 一表中连接键是索引列、另一表连接键是非索引列 left1 = pd.DataFrame({'key':['a','b','a','a','b','c'],'value': range(6)}) left1 1 2 key value 0 a 0 1 b 1 2 a...
merge函数的主要参数包括: left:要合并的左侧数据框。 right:要合并的右侧数据框。 how:合并类型,默认为’inner’,表示只保留两个数据框都有的键值对;还可以选择’left’或’right’,表示分别保留左侧或右侧的键值对。 on:用于合并的列名,可以是左侧或右侧数据框中的列名。如果未指定,则默认为两个数据框都有的...
参数如下: 3.基础案例 3.1on关键字演示 3.2left_on 和 right_on 关键字 3.3left_index 和 right_index 关键字 3.4数据连接的类型 3.4.1 1.前言 在数据合并操作中,有两个操作函数pd.caoncat()和pd.merge(),这两个函数在使用过程中经常会拿来比较,只要我们弄懂了其中重要参数的意义,理解每一个函数的用法,就...
python 的 merge 函数 Merge 函数是 pandas 库中的一个函数,用于将不同数 据结构的数据进行合并。该函数有三个参数:left:左边的 DataFrame;right:右边的 DataFrame;how:合并方式, 默认为 inner,即取两者共有的部分;on:根据 left 和 right 两边相同名字的列进行合并,若此参数不设定,则默 认取 left 和 right...
一、Merge/UnMerge函数介绍 Merge函数从指定的Range对象创建合并的单元格。 UnMerge函数将合并区域分解为独立的单元格。 1.1 Merge语法 Range.Merge(Across) 1.1.1参数 1.2 UnMerge语法 Range.UnMerge() 1.2.1 参数--无 二、Python代码示例 importwin32com.clientaswinexcel=win.Dispatch("Excel.Application")excel....
Merge函数是Python中非常常用的函数之一,它可以将两个或多个数据框按照一定的条件合并成一个新的数据框。在数据分析和处理中,经常需要将不同数据源的数据进行整合,此时就可以使用merge函数来完成。_x000D_ Merge函数的基本用法如下:_x000D_ `python_x000D_ pd.merge(left, right, how='inner', on=None...